Beauty Review: The Look of Fall At Estee Lauder


There are many beauty trends for the up-coming Fall season but one that stands out to me is definitely the return of the glam look of the 1940's. Estee Lauder's version is a more modern take of the Old Hollywood glam. The gorgeous After Hours Collection sets the mood with silver smoked greys, scarlet reds, and shimmer in all the right places. I love the Brillant Shimmer All Over Powder that can be used to highlight the areas that catch the light. Just swirl your brush over the shimmering rose powder and voila instant glow! The Pure Color Eyeshadow in Smokey Moon is a smoked out silver grey and is full of velvety rich colour perfect for a sultry eye. It blends smoothly onto the skin. The Double Wear Stay-in-Place Shadow Stick in Silver Pearl is a perfect compliment to the eyeshadow and can be used in the inner corner and brow bone for highlighting. I applied it early morning one day and it stayed on until the late hours of the evening without a crease in sight! I fell in love with the Pure Color Long Lasting Lipstick in After Hours Red. It really complimented my skin tone and the colour was rich and smooth. It also lasted through a few cups of coffee!
